All built up and ready to ride:-

(IMG:http://i3.photobucket.com/albums/y79/dingobmxer/alliant-1.jpg)

S&M forks/stem/bars/grips and 36t Tuffman chainring
GT/Profile cranks
Easton pedals
Raceface seatpost
Atomlab rims on primo hubs
Comp 3's
XTR brake and lever
